CORPUS CHRISTI- Overcast with light rain and drizzle through the morning as the front comes through. Rain moves out this afternoon with a breezy cool down into the mid-60s. Wind: N 15-25mph.
Overcast tonight. Low: 44. Wind: N 10-20mph.
Wednesday another round of showers as an area of low pressure moves over South Texas. Temperatures chilly in the 40s and 50s.
Rain moves out Thursday, but it stays cloudy.
Friday could have a little drizzle and it stays chilly and cloudy Friday and Saturday.
Warm up gets going Sunday and Monday with some sunshine.
